The Nuclear Science Symposium (NSS) offers an outstanding opportunity for scientists and engineers interested or actively working in the fields of nuclear science, radiation instrumentation, software and their applications, to meet and discuss with colleagues from around the world. The program emphasizes the latest developments in technology and instrumentation and their implementation in experiments for space, accelerators, other radiation environments, and homeland security. Topical Workshops cover areas of specific interest. Within the framework of an educational scientific program, Short Courses are organized focusing on topics of interest for the scientific community. Authors are invited to submit papers describing original unpublished works in the topics areas listed below: * Accelerators and Beam Line Instrumentation * Analog and Digital Circuits * Astrophysics and Space Instrumentation * Computing and Software for Experiments * Data Acquisition and Analysis Systems * Gamma-ray Imaging * Gaseous Detectors * High Energy Physics instrumentation * Instrumentation for Homeland Security * Instrumentation for Medical and Biological Research * Neutron Imaging and Radiography * New Detector Concepts and Instrumentation * Nuclear Measurements and Monitoring Techniques * Nuclear Physics Instrumentation * Nuclear Power * Photodetectors and Scintillation Detectors * Radiation Damage Effects * Semiconductor Detectors * Synchrotron Radiation Instrumentation * Trigger and Front-End Systems
